It is very important to keep your tongue clean and healthy. Clean your tongue with a tongue scraper after brushing and flossing your teeth. Tongue scrapers are dental tools that are both cheap in price and highly effective at getting rid of extra and harmful bacteria from your tongue’s surface. If you don’t like the scraper, or don’t have access to one, try using your regular toothbrush to get your tongue clean instead.

Talk with your dentist before starting any whitening regimen. Some of the chemicals used in these products can actually damage your teeth. A lot of them are safe for you to use, but it is not always easy to tell the difference between the two. Your dentist will guide you find the ideal product.

If your dentist says you must have a deep cleaning, visit another dentist for a second opinion. This type of cleaning is more extensive and costs much more, so you have to be sure that this dentist is not recommending this just to profit from you.

Brush your teeth away from the gums. This grabs the food debris and gets it away from your gums so they are cleaned completely. If you wish to scrub your teeth in a sideways fashion first, that’s okay if you follow it using a down and up motion.

When you care for the health and cleanliness of your teeth, gums and tongue, you are preventing volatile sulfur compounds that cause bad odors. These are a result of food debris being broken down food and bacteria.

If you cannot afford dental work, you should ask your dentist if you can pay in several installments. Often dentists offer a direct payment plan or offer the option of using a financing company. This is a good way to break the cost down into affordable chunks.
